I resolved the problem . I am able to start the vmware as per my
requirements.
The command works  as <command mode="'shell'">'%s %s %s ' % (vmware_root,
start, vmware_name[0]) </command>

> I am trying to start a vmware from a stax job .
>
> From the command line of a windows machine we can start  a vmware by doing
> a:
>
>
> "C:\Program Files\VMware\VMware Workstation\vmrun.exe" start
> "C:\vmware\RedHat\rhel3.vmx"
>
> Considering if i want to start the vmware "C:\vmware\RedHat\rhel3.vmx".
>
>
> Now i want the same to be done from a stax job.
>
> The machine from where i am trying to start the vmware is staf-stax active
> i.e staf runs here .
> Now the code i use is (I am not using the function which is there in the
> STAF faq ,i am simply trying to use the command to start the vmware.)
> somemachine = machine where staf and stax is running already.
>
> <script>
>
>  vmware_name = ['"c:\\vmware\RedHat\rhel3.vmx"']
>  vmware_root = '"c:\\Program Files\VMware\\VMware Workstation\\vmrun.exe"'
>  machList = ['somemachine']
>  start = 'start'
>
> </script>
>
>
>   <paralleliterate var="machName" in="machList" indexvar="i">
>         <process name="'Starting VMware on machine %s.....' % machName">
>               <location>machName</location>
>               <command mode="'shell'">'%s %s %s ' % (vmware_root, start,
> vmware_name) </command>
>         </process>
>     </paralleliterate>
>
>
> Kindly suggest any improvements so that i can start the vmware just by
> giving the command.
